**Ticket #—: Missed pick-up, Fennick Depot uniforms**

Driver missed the 07:00 collection of new uniforms for Fennick Depot staging at Orrel Garmentworks. Depot opens Monday; uniforms must arrive Friday latest. Reassign to the afternoon route. Confirm with Garmentworks that the crates are palletised and ready at dock 2. Driver should perform the hand-over exactly as stated in the confidential line below.

handover note for yagef-bagep: the drudor pelius courier leaves the kasdor zorvan norir ledger at gate 8016 under passcode 755406

## Deployment

Gatecount runs as a single binary per turnstile bank, reporting entry tallies to the Rowanfield stadium aggregator. Deploy one instance per gate cluster; do not share instances across stands. Plugins load from the plugins directory at startup only — restart after installing. Health endpoint must return ready before the aggregator will accept counts, so stage deploys between events. Clock skew over two seconds breaks tally reconciliation. The deployment expects the following configuration values.

config for kafof-bawef:
holath:
  log_level: debug
  metrics_host: metrics.holath.qorvelsys.internal
  pin: 2191
  pool_size: 32

### RestockPilot: Release Prerequisites

Before cutting a release, confirm that the RestockPilot planner can reach the SnackGrid inventory service, since the build pipeline runs an integration smoke test against staging during packaging. A failed handshake here blocks the release tag, so verify credentials first. The pipeline reads its staging credential from the deploy config; for reference and manual verification, the current key appears below.

service key, tajof-fawip: vxb4-JNOz